Fluid Coupling for Smooth Power Transfer and Protection
Fluid Coupling is a soft-start transmission system used to transmit power between rotating shafts. It uses fluid dynamics. Fluid couplings are widely used in conveyor systems. They help reduce shock loads, ensuring safe operation.
Precision Gear Reduction Technology
Harmonic Drive is a compact reduction mechanism that provides high torque in small size. It is widely used in aerospace systems. Its high accuracy makes it ideal for precision automation.
